几个Link错误的解决
来源:互联网 发布:2017赛尔号刷米币软件 编辑:程序博客网 时间:2024/06/05 15:19
写了个测试程序来测试人工写的strcpy函数,就那么几行代码,没想到一运行竟然出现了link错误:
libcd.lib(strcat.obj) : error LNK2005: _strcpy already defined in Cpp1.obj
nafxcwd.lib(thrdcore.obj) : error LNK2001: unresolved external symbol __endthreadex
nafxcwd.lib(thrdcore.obj) : error LNK2001: unresolved external symbol __beginthreadex
Debug/Cpp1.exe : fatal error LNK1120: 2 unresolved externals
解决办法:
1. 把程序中strcpy的名字改下。error LNK2005 表明strcpy已经定义,这才想起strcpy是库函数,在程序中把strcpy改成strCPY,再运行就没有出现error LNK2005了
2.在vc的【工程】--设置--常规--Microsoft基础类 的下拉框里选择【使用MFC作为共享的DLL】,再运行通过。原因是:测试程序中使用了mfc的宏,只是添加了afx.h,而没有设置库文件。
- 几个Link错误的解决
- 解决link错误的一些心得
- 解决Link 2001错误的一种方法
- 几个错误的解决关键
- VC6 各link错误解决
- 面对几个错误的解决关键
- 面对几个错误的解决关键
- Hibernate 面对几个错误的解决关键
- 图像处理特征提取(一):LINK错误的解决
- 解决J-Link的"ERROR: Can not connect to J-Link."错误 2
- link error 2001错误及解决
- Apache 安装出现的几个错误解决心得(菜鸟级)
- VC6.0 --> VS2003 转换过程中的几个错误的解决
- 解决xp虚拟机下oracle的几个错误
- 黑马程序员_解决数据库连接的几个错误
- 安装joomla过程中phpmyadmin几个错误的解决
- Android项目javadoc时出现的几个错误解决
- keilc 4 编译出现的几个错误解决
- 家庭管理
- 对读研和软件学院的看法-转
- JID格式的问题
- phpcms删除了工作流以后会出现很多地方要改啊
- Ext 等待提示
- 几个Link错误的解决
- MS-SQL SERVER(2)
- 使用GraphEdit使用
- Ubuntu Apache 配置
- VC:执行远程线程注入的代码段导致目标进程崩溃
- vimperator 回复ctrl-c ctrl-v快捷键
- C中全局变量和函数声明的认识
- 真值悖论
- Ext combox 取得显示的值和设定默认值